## THE FORGOTTEN FIELDS (NOVEL) – Chapter 172

He watched that scene, having forgotten even how to breathe.

The strands of her wheat-colored hair, which appeared and disappeared among the dense bushes, sparkled like pure gold under the sunlight that fell like rain.

Those dazzling threads of light slid over her porcelain face and clung like spiderwebs to her damp neck and collarbone.

He froze in his tracks, dumbfounded, and then began to push his way through the crowded trees.

With each crystalline laugh that resonated like waves amidst the rustling leaves, he felt a chill run down his spine, as if he had been struck by lightning.

He felt a strange thirst burning his throat as he left behind the rhododendron bushes that blocked his view.

It was then that she revealed herself completely to him, submerging her body up to her waist in the spring waters that gleamed like silver.

He stopped dead in his tracks and swallowed hard, feeling his throat constrict tightly.

She wore a cream-colored silk dress that hung loosely on her.

The delicate fabric, soaked by the water, clung to her body like a second skin, highlighting her slender silhouette and pronounced curves without any kind of filter.

Before he had time to become enraged by her exposed appearance, the echo of her joyful voice resonated once more in the air:

“What a good boy. Stay still.”

The woman extended her slender arms over the surface of the water and pulled the head of a massive wolf toward her chest.

Only then did he notice the existence of that gigantic silver beast that the bushes had kept hidden.

The wolf poked only its head out of the water and let out a low growl, as if resisting its mistress’s touch, tilting its head back. At that moment, the woman tightly wrapped her arms around the wolf’s neck, held its gray-furred snout with one hand, and began to rub its neck and fluffy face with a rough brush.

Apparently, the matter was not to the wolf’s liking, so its resistance increased a bit.

She hugged it tightly from behind while it tried to twist its massive, submerged body to escape from the spring.

“There is no escape!”

A mischievous and joyful smile illuminated her small and delicate face.

While he watched the scene in shock, as if he had received a blow to the stomach, her blue eyes locked with his by pure chance, right as she remained clinging to the body of the huge wolf.

Varkas watched with bitterness as the smile vanished from her face, to be replaced by an intense tension.

The woman tensed completely, as if she had seen a ghost, and then slowly hid behind the wolf to conceal herself.

“I… heard you would arrive within four days…”

“I returned in a hurry after learning that a problem had arisen,” he replied in a voice completely devoid of emotion.

After appearing bewildered and anxious by his sudden appearance, she abruptly arched her eyebrows severely.

“There is no problem.”

She wrapped her white, damp arms around the neck of the huge wolf and cast a look loaded with caution at him.

“I don’t know who went around babbling such things, but it is a blatant lie. They are just making up excuses to get rid of Khan…”

“Khan?”

The woman, who was raising her voice with her face flushed from agitation, suddenly fell silent.

A faint blush appeared on her cheeks.

“That is his name. It was…” she murmured while she played with the wolf’s pointed ear.

Varkas exhaled a sigh of dumbfoundedness.

He felt a headache that threatened to tear him apart at the audacity of his wife, who had given a name proper to the peoples of the East to a mere beast.

He dictated his orders in a dry tone:

“Get out of there first. We will return to the castle to talk.”

The woman, who until then had only shown her eyes out of the water, moved forward, positioning herself behind the wolf.

Varkas slowly examined that wild beast that climbed onto the shore first.

The gray “giant wolf” possessed an imposing body that made it difficult to believe it had not yet reached three years of age.

It had long and robust legs that brimmed with power, a muscular and massive neck, a developed jaw, and sharp fangs…

It gave the impression that its height from the ground to its head reached nearly 180 cm, and its body length far exceeded 210 cm.

Thinking that it was barely the size of a slightly large wild dog the last time he saw it, its growth was astonishing.

‘They said it was the size of a Trojan horse, or the size of an ox… I thought it was an exaggeration…’

Rather, the strange thing was that no incidents had occurred while a beast of such magnitude roamed the territory.

He examined its long and bushy tail that dripped with water, and then returned his gaze to the wolf’s head.

When his eyes met those of the animal, which were filled with hostility and fixed on him, he furrowed his brow.

The wolf lowered the upper part of its body and began to growl.

Varkas perceived a clear murderous intent, so he immediately placed his hand on the hilt of his sword. At that instant, the woman, who had just stepped out of the water, interposed herself between him and the wolf.

“Don’t do that, Khan!” she exclaimed, and then slapped the snout of the wolf, which was baring its fangs, with the palm of her hand.

Feeling alarmed by that dangerous action, Varkas grabbed her wrist tightly to pull her away from the wolf.

Just as he was preparing to reprimand her severely, his field of vision was flooded with her feminine figure, completely drenched.

Varkas held his breath unconsciously.

Without realizing it, his gaze slid over her rounded chest, her flat belly, and moved toward her small and deep navel, stopping at her thighs.

Due to her appearance that bordered on nudity, blood boiled in his veins and, at the same time, an indescribable fury ignited within him.

He shot a sharp glance toward the guards who remained at a distance with their backs turned. The mere thought that they might have seen this scene made his nerves tense.

“Where are your outer garments?”

The woman, who had frozen, seemed to notice her state belatedly; she covered her chest with one arm and pointed toward an imposing tree beside the spring.

“I hung them over there.”

Varkas immediately took the clothing hanging from the tree branch and wrapped her in it.

“Do you usually wander around in this attire?”

When he formulated the question with an incisive tone, she replied sharply while her cheeks flushed red:

“I only took off the outer garment for a moment to wash Khan. In any case, with Khan present, nobody else approaches.”

“Someone could be spying from afar.”

“Anyone who did received a severe punishment from Khan.”

The woman let out a loud snort through her nose, and then, noticing his gaze, quickly added:

“It’s not that Khan hurt anyone. He only scared them to keep them from approaching me.”

Then she began to gently stroke the neck of the “giant wolf” that had sat down quietly behind her.

Varkas narrowed his eyes while he observed the wolf, which was wagging its tail for its mistress.

The beast that a moment ago showed murderous intentions toward him was now behaving in a docile manner, like a loyal hound with its owner.

Based solely on that image, it did not seem to represent a threat to her.

However, no one knew at what moment the innate aggressiveness of wild beasts might manifest.

He pushed her cautiously behind his back while remaining on alert, ready to draw his sword at any instant.

At that moment, the beast, which was pretending to be calm, bared its fangs again.

Seeing that, Talia raised her voice with fear:

“Khan! That is not right. This person is…!”

The woman, who was trying to calm the wolf in a hurry, suddenly went mute and examined Varkas’s features. She looked extremely worried that he might do something to the animal.

“Khan hates men by nature. It seems he retains the memory of having been on the verge of dying at the hands of soldiers when he was a pup. He only does that because he is afraid…”

“We will postpone judgment on this beast.”

Varkas interrupted her desperate defense and fixed a cold gaze on the wolf. The animal also observed him with blue eyes that gleamed intensely.

Was it perhaps enraged because its mistress felt distressed? It gave the impression that the wolf longed to tear his throat out immediately.

He nodded to her to move forward, while holding the hilt of the sword to be ready to react instantly:

“Walk ahead of me. I will hear the details when we return to the castle.”

“Khan, come here,” she indicated to the wolf with a worried face.

Varkas stood firmly, interposing himself between the two.

“No, you go first.”

“Khan gets anxious if he moves away from me.”

“I cannot allow him to remain near Your Highness until I have made sure that he really is harmless.”

At that moment, the woman, visibly indignant, shot a glaring look at him, broke free from his grip with force, and ran toward the wolf.

Before he could stop her, she opened the beast’s jaws and inserted her hand inside.

“Look. He doesn’t bite even if I do this. He only pretends to be strong, but he is docile.”

Feeling his blood freeze in his veins, Varkas wrapped his arm around her waist as if he were kidnapping her and lifted her up in the air.

The wolf also seemed surprised by its mistress’s sudden action, so it retreated quickly, letting out a sort of cough.
